Real Estate Values and Property Tax Valuation in Wayne County, Illinois
Wayne County has a total of 2,000 properties with a cumulative value of $168.8M, representing 0.02% of all real estate value in Illinois. The total property taxes collected in Wayne County across these 2,000 properties was $3.6M, with an average property tax rate of 2.10%, lower than the state average of 2.47%. The average homeowner in Wayne County pays $1,820 in property taxes, significantly lower than the state average of $5,405. Property taxes are calculated based on the assessed value of the property, which is typically lower than the market value.
In Illinois, property taxes are based on the value of the property as of January 1st. Property owners have the option to appeal their property taxes between June and December, or within 30 days of when the notices are published. Property tax bills are issued on February 1st and July 1st, with the first installment due on June 1st in Cook County. This first installment is estimated at 55% of the prior year's tax bill, with taxes paid in arrears.

Residential Property Taxes by Cities in Wayne County
Wayne County has an average property tax rate of 2.10%, which is slightly lower than the national average of 2.18%. This rate is applied to all properties in the county, regardless of location. However, there is some variation in the effective property tax rate across the cities in Wayne County. The city of Fairfield has the highest effective property tax rate at 2.19%, while the city of Cisne has the lowest effective property tax rate at 2.05%. This means that property owners in Fairfield will pay slightly more in property taxes than those in Cisne.

Mortgage Rates in Wayne County
Wayne County has a total of $8.4M in outstanding home mortgage loans. This amount represents 70 loans, with the median mortgage rate across the county being 4.3%. However, there is a significant variation in mortgage rates across the county, with Fairfield having the highest median rate of 4.5%, and Cisne having the lowest median rate of 4.02%.
